I have CY GY but first tried to get CY GUY and it was taken (this was in '97 I think). Oddly enough the DMV told me at the time that the person that had it lived in Seattle.

I know when I looked into getting a plate for my dad a few years back, there were some very good plates that were suprisingly not taken but I can't recall what they were specifically now. The best thing to do is see if you can get some patient person at the DMV (hahaha) that will look up your possible choices so you can rule them out before you fill out the app and have to keep resubmitting it. By the way, we may have better chances of winning the National Championship this year than you do of finding a patient DMV worker:) **

There is also a waiting list you can supposedly be put on at the DMV but you may never get the plate since most plates just transfer to your new vehicles now.
